How to Love Everyone and Almost Get Away with It
Discover the captivating world of How to Love Everyone and Almost Get Away with It by Lara Egger, published by the University of Massachusetts Press in 2021. This engaging collection of poems delves into the complexities of desire, shame, and the struggle to embrace one’s true self during a midlife crisis.
With 88 pages filled with humor and poignancy, Egger's work features a vibrant cast of characters, including unruly angels and earthbound astronauts, all woven together through clever wordplay and imaginative imagery. Each poem serves as a transformative journey, inviting readers to explore the intricacies of the human experience, one line at a time.
